#60572f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#60572f is composed of 37.6% red, 34.1%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 9.4% magenta, 51% yellow and 62.4% black. It has a hue angle of 49 degrees, a saturation of 34.3% and a lightness of 28%. #60572f color hex could be obtained by blending #c0ae5e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#60572f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#60572f has RGB values of R:96, G:87, B:47 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.09, Y:0.51,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 6313775.
